Popular Examples and Their Impact
Some noteworthy city building games that have left a significant impact include:
- SimCity: A pioneer that has defined the genre.
- Cities: Skylines: Redefined modern city management with expansive tools.
- Anno 1800: Combining city building with trade and diplomacy.
